What AthenaHQ does
AthenaHQ positions itself as a GEO and AI search citation intelligence platform. Per athenahq.ai, the product tracks brand and competitor mentions across AI answer engines and gives marketing teams source-level insight into which pages, domains, and content formats AI models cite. The platform is built for marketing and PR teams that want to understand citation share, source authority, and competitive positioning inside AI-generated answers. Where many GEO tools surface mentions, AthenaHQ goes a layer deeper into the citation graph.
